3 Tests and Diagnostics

3.31 SETUP

(b)PCI Express Link ASPM

This option set the power-saving function of PCI Express on the following conditions.

Auto

PCI Express devices are not used while battery

 

operation. (Default)

Disabled

Disable the Power-saving function and drive

 

with maximum performance.

Enabled

PCI Express devices are not used.

(c)Enhanced C-States *Core2 model only

This option set the power-saving function of Enhanced C-States on the following conditions.

Enabled

This lowers the power consumption. (Default)

Disabled

This does not lower the power consumption.

8. .I/O ports

 

This option controls settings for the parallel port.

NOTE: Do not assign the same interrupt request level and I/O address to the serial port and PC card.

(a)Serial

Use this option to set the COM level for the serial port. The serial port interrupt request level (IRQ) and I/O port base address for each COM level is shown below:

COM level

Interrupt level

I/O address

 

COM1

4

3F8H

(Serial port default)

COM2

3

2F8H

 

COM3

4

3E8H

 

COM3

5

3E8H

 

COM3

7

3E8H

 

COM4

3

2E8H

 

COM4

5

2E8H

 

COM4

7

2E8H

 

Not Used

Disables port
